How does renting a van in Falmouth actually work? Most providers offer pre-inspected, well-maintained vans equipped for multi-day travel—complete with beds, storage, and basic appliances. Customers receive full access to GPS navigation, fuel allowances, and support for route planning. Rentals are flexible, often tailored to weeks or months, allowing travelers to adapt their itinerary as inspiration strikes. This model supports seasonal exploration, whether chasing coastal sunrises in summer or fall foliage in the mountains—all from one accessible base.

Why is From Beaches to Mountains: Rent a Van in Falmouth and Keep Exploring! gaining traction now? Several cultural and economic shifts fuel its momentum. Urban dwellers increasingly seek retreat from crowded cities, seeking authentic, slow-paced excellence—something a van enables by removing transit fatigue. At the same time, rising fuel and lodging costs encourage more people to optimize travel logistics with cost-effective, all-in-one transportation and lodging. The rise of remote work further fuels flexibility, letting professionals extend stays across varied landscapes without sacrificing comfort.

Falmouth, nestled along the Sunny Cape in coastal Massachusetts, isn’t just a gateway to the beach—it’s a launchpad for exploring both coastal serenity and mountain landscapes. Renting a van here offers travelers a flexible base to transition seamlessly from sunlit shores to remote trails, offering unmatched access to hidden coves, scenic overlooks, and mountain vistas within easy drive time. This dual-access model responds to a rising demand for travel that honors both relaxation and exploration.
